Samuel Mc Nutt was born in 1802 in Derry, Ireland. He married Jane Tomilson (ca. 1802-1847) in 1831 in Sheffield, New Brunswick, Canada. Samuel died in 1847 in Tay Creek, New Brunswick. Samuel and Jane had seven children. Descendants live throughout Canada and the United States.

Jacob Jans Schermerhorn was born in Holland, ca. 1622, and is thought to have come to America as a boy to assist in building a mill at Rensselaerwyck (Albany, New York). He and his wife, Janettie Egmont, had at least five sons. The family moved to Schenectady soon after its settlement in 1662. Descendants of his son, Ryer Jacobse Schermerhorn (1652-1719), listed lived in New York, Indiana, Michigan, and elsewhere.

James MacQueen, son of Archibald MacQueen and Flora McDonald, was born in about 1760 on the Isle of Syke, Scotland. He emigrated in about 1722 and settled in North Carolina. He married Ann MacRae and they had twelve children. Their daughter, Maria MacQueen, married Peter McEachin, son of John McEachin and Flora Graham, in 1827. Descendants and relatives lived mainly in North Carolina, Tennesee, Mississippi and Texas.

James Bell was born ca. 1750 in Derby Co., Ireland and immigrated to the United States ca. 1771. He married Mary Ford (born ca. 1759 in Philadelphia, Pa.) 25 February 1777 in Philadelphia. They settled in Lack Township (now Juniata Co.) Pa. and reared eight children. James died 1826 in Lack Township. Descendants lived primarily in Pennsylvania, Ohio, Indiana and elsewhere.

William Sloan (1794-1830), direct descendant of Alexander Sloane (ca.1622-1666), married Elizabeth Simpson in 1815, and emigrated in 1820/1822 from Ireland to New York City. Descendants and relatives lived in New York, New Jersey, Ohio, Wisconsin, Minnesota, Illinois and elsewhere. Includes ancestors in Ireland back to Francis Sloane, who emigrated from Scotland to Ireland and was the father of Alexander Sloane.

George Radford (1844-1919), son of John and Mary Radford, married Mary Ann Capewell, and immigrated in 1870 from England to Niles, Trumbull County, Ohio. Descendants and relatives lived in Ohio, North Carolina, Georgia, Alabama and elsewhere.

A genealogy of the ancestors and descendants of Henrietta Maria Hamilton born 25 MY 1822 in Rockbridge County, Virginia the daughter of John Hamilton and Elizabeth McNutt. She married 22 Oct 1845 Leander James McCormick in Walnut Grove, Rockbridge County, Virginia. They moved to Chicago in 1848.

James Ardery (ca.1735-1793), by tradition a Scotch-Irish immigrant, moved to Fannet Township, Franklin County, Pennsylvania and married Sarah McGarvey (?). Descendants and relatives lived in Pennsylvania, Michigan, California, Nevada and elsewhere.

Robert Tomilson was born ca. 1804 in Ballykelly, Ireland. Robert married 1) Ellen Coyle. They had one child, Eliza Tomilson (1830-1932) born in Armagh, Ireland. Robert married 2) Alnor Coal (Ellinor Coyle, ca. 1816-ca. 1851) in 1833 in Douglas, York County, New Brunswick, Canada. Contains reports on the families of Robert and Ellinor's ten children. Descendants live throughout Canada and the United States. .
